Architect Engineering Mgr II
- Budget Oversight: Develop, manage and monitor budgets for assigned programs and projects in support of goals and objectives. Ensure expenditures do not exceed allocations. Manage budgets to ensure metrics are met.
- Engineering Management: Lead team and develop policies, procedures and practices in management of assigned engineering program area. Develop and provide technical guidance and recommendations on engineering projects.
- Program Administration: Assist in the coordination and representation of VDOT in public involvement meeting processes to include development of public involvement documents, coordination of meeting logistics, preparation of pre-meetings, participation in public involvement meetings, preparation of transcripts, development of district recommendations for approval by VDOT management and the Commonwealth Transportation Board and administrative notifications. Assist in the communication and facilitation of activities with citizens, community groups, homeowner associations, businesses, local transportation and government officials and media to accomplish objectives.
- Program Development: Assist in the management and coordination of Local Assistance engineering activities ensuring project development for roadway systems is developed from inception through completion in compliance with VDOT policies and procedures. Provide oversight of formal agreements for projects administered by localities. Monitor and track the development and progress of Local Assistance activities using VDOT's PPMS, financial and related automated systems.
- Program Management: Assist in developing financial strategies, monitor actual costs, determine variance, forecast overruns and make adjustments to ensure project needs are accomplished. Represent VDOT at County Board of Supervisor's meetings to coordinate actions related to Local Assistance Engineering.
- Project Management and Communication: Manage communication and coordination between project team members and stakeholders. Advise key stakeholders on significant issues affecting project schedules, milestones, budget objectives or team performance. Establish and maintain communications with project team members. Schedule and coordinate project team meetings and milestone reviews. Respond to project inquiries from public, legislature, government agencies, planning agencies, media, citizen groups, stakeholders and special interest groups.
- Responsible Charge Engineer: Fulfill duties as responsible charge engineer in compliance with policies, procedures and the Code of Virginia.
- Staff Training and Development: Ensure staff development, performance planning, evaluation and recognition activities are completed to ensure a productive and motivated team.
